    George Karl defends Warren Jabali. Jabali played in Denver for the Rockets in 1972-73 and 1973-74. The Spurs moved from Dallas to San Antonio for the 1973-74 season, George Karl's first with the Spurs. Therefore, this photo was taken in 1973-74 season. That white numeraled Spurs' away jersey shown earlier in this thread was from the 1974 season (right-click "properties" of the pic to see the year of the jersey), so that was probably the only season they had the white numerals before going to the black.
